root / manifests / rules / dns.pp @ 04176b0e
Historique | Voir | Annoter | Télécharger (280 octets)
1 | 8227cb1c | tr | # manage in dns |
---|---|---|---|
2 | 11bf7237 | Steve Traylen | class nftables::rules::dns ( |
3 | 31b17627 | Steve Traylen | Array[Integer,1] $ports = [53], |
4 | 8227cb1c | tr | ) { |
5 | 11bf7237 | Steve Traylen | nftables::rule { |
6 | 8227cb1c | tr | 'default_in-dns_tcp': |
7 | content => "tcp dport {${join($ports,', ')}} accept"; |
||
8 | 'default_in-dns_udp': |
||
9 | content => "udp dport {${join($ports,', ')}} accept"; |
||
10 | } |
||
11 | } |